Saints Row 4 has a lot more content than Saints Row 3

Saints Row 4 is shaping up to be a fantastic game and a lot more crazy then the previous installments in the series, but fans will be pleased to know that it also contains a lot more content than the previous games.

They are also planning a robust DLC plan for Saints Row 4 and it seems to have been outsourced as well. The game was sort of unveiled again and a trailer was also released which you can check out here.

“Size wise, the main story mission is about the same length. Open world content? Fuck ton more. Way more, it’s absurd. When you ask me what do you say to fans who are worried about there not being enough content on the disc, I say you’re not ready. You have no idea,” creative director Steve Jaros told Destructoid.

“The other day I was playing the build, I was supposed to be reviewing dialogue in different missions, right? I’m on this path, and I stop and go ‘oh there’s this open world thing I want to go and do!’ It’s four hours later, I’ve only played three missions in like four hours. It just pulls you in with all this open world content for you to explore and do, and there’s so much of it.”

The game will be released this year for the PS3, Xbox 360 and PC. The Wii U version has yet to be confirmed and is probably not happening along with the next gen versions.
